Around 2 pm as I was driving along Triphammer Rd in Cayuga Heights, a
gang of TURKEY VULTURES rose suddenly out of the stand of pines along
the W side of the road just a few hundred yards north of Community
Corners. There were about 30 birds- hard to count through my
windshield as they wheeled upward in a tight bunch. It looked as if they
had been roosting and were flushed out by something. They headed off in
a southwesterly direction.
